Pizzerias, trattorias, osterias, and enotecas are just a few examples of the types of establishments where you can enjoy casual Italian cuisine. **Types of Restaurants in Italy:** Italy boasts a diverse array of restaurants, each with its own unique ambiance, menu offerings, and specialties. Trattorias are cozy family-run eateries that serve homestyle dishes in a warm and welcoming setting. Ristorantes are more formal dining establishments that offer an extensive menu featuring classic Italian dishes paired with an impressive wine selection. Osterias are quaint taverns known for their rustic charm and simple yet delicious food. Enotecas specialize in wine and often serve small plates to accompany tastings.
